Conflicts of interest loom for Brexit Party MEPs

Almost all of the Brexit Party MEPs have joined standing committees, with several of them joining committees that could lead to potential conflicts of interest.

In fact, Brexit Party leader Nigel Farage is the only one who has not joined any committee.

In total, 27 of the 29 Brexit Party MEPs have joined at least one committee as full member - and some have joined two - while many are also a substitute member of another committee as well.
